Expression of vascular endothelial growth factor in oral squamous cell carcinoma

Abstract

Objectives: The goal of this study was to determine the correlation of clinicopathological factors and the up-regulation of vascular endothelial growth factor (VEGF) expression in oral squamous cell carcinoma.Materials and Methods: Immunohistochemical staining of VEGF and quantitative real-time polymerase chain reaction (RT-PCR) of VEGF mRNA were performed in 20 specimens from 20 patients with oral squamous cell carcinoma and another 20 specimens from 20 patients with carcinoma in situ as a controlled group.Results: The results were as follows: 1) In immunohistochemical study of poorly differentiated and invasive oral squamous cell carcinoma, high-level staining of VEGF was observed. Significantcorrelation was observed between immunohistochemical VEGF expression and histologic differentia-tion, tumor size of specimens (Pearson correlation analysis, significancer>0.6, P<0.05). 2) In VEGF quantitative RT-PCR analysis, progressive cancer showed more VEGF expression than carcinoma in situ. Paired-samples analysis determined the difference of VEGF mRNA expression level between cancer tissue and carcinoma in situ tissue, between T1 and T2-4 (Student’s t-test, P<0.05).Conclusion: These fndings suggest that up-regulation of VEGF may play a role in the angiogenesis and progression of oral squamous cell carcinoma.
